The story that we select is about a man called
Walidmir that has a Poland Syndrome. That syndrome causes absence of some
muscles of upper side of his body and congenital amputation of some fingers. He
has gone to Teletón since he had two months old.
Now a physiologist called Jorge zúñiga made a hand of
plastic whit a three dimensions printer for Wladimir. This hand cost twenty five
dollars and is more comfortable because is most light and have a similar
structure of a real hand.
